The paper investigates the problem of robust stability analysis and robust stabilization via memoryless state feedback for uncertain difference switched systems with multiple state delays. Based on the Lyapunov-Krasovskii functional theory, delay-dependent sufficient Linear Matrix Inequalities (LMIs) conditions are established for the stability and stabilization of the considered system using some...
In this paper, we address the robust Hinfin control problem of discrete-time switched linear systems with exponential uncertainties. By using Taylor series approximation and convex polytope technique, exponential uncertain discrete-time switched linear system is transformed into an equivalent switched polytopic model with an additive norm bounded uncertainty. In this paper, robust stabilization problems for Networked Control System (NCS) with data loss are investigated. We treat the data dropouts caused by network transmission data rate limit as a switch and obtain the discrete-time linear stochastic switch model for NCS.
